At 73, Michel Barnier became the first Savoyard to be appointed Prime Minister on Thursday, September 5, 2024. Yann Barthès did not hide his pride in “Quotidien” a little later in the day on TMC. The host decided to review the content of his show to celebrate this historic act.

After finding itself in a political impasse that lasted 51 days, France (finally) has a new Prime Minister! It was precisely 1:22 p.m. on Thursday, September 5, 2024 when the Elysée announced that Emmanuel Macron had officially chosen Michel Barnier to succeed Gabriel Attal.

Yann Barthès celebrates the appointment of a Savoyard to Matignon

The arrival of Michel Barnier at Matignon has caused an unexpected last-minute upheaval in Daily. Yann Barthès decided to urgently review the first minutes of his show to celebrate a historic act. Michel Barnier is the first Savoyard – the region where the TMC host comes from – to be appointed to the post of head of government.

“That’s it, we’re here! We had to wait 51 days, we finally have a Prime Minister! And not just any Prime Minister! For many of us, he is Prime Minister, but above all he is from Savoy!”exclaimed the presenter who opened his 9th season of Daily on apologies. He then got up from his seat and brandished skis, all while the flag of Savoy appeared behind him.

The Savoyard anthem now opens Daily every evening

As the anthem of his native region resounded on the set, Yann Barthès chanted: For the first time in history, a Savoyard is at Matignon!
